Now that the weather is warming up, OPP officers are seeing a rise in the amount of motorcycles on the roads.
WOODSTOCK - As the nicer weather approaches the OPP would like to remind drivers to pay attention to motorcyclists on the road.
Constable Ed Sanchuk tells Heart FM that taking an extra second before pulling into an intersection can save lives.
"We're going to see a higher number of motorcyclists and bicyclists on the roadways. So before entering into an intersection or changing lanes always take an extra second to look both ways and check for other vehicles including motorcycles. Taking an extra second or two can and does save lives."
Sanchuk also says that when driving behind a motorcycle it's best to give them enough room to operate their vehicle safely.
"I would be giving them the distance that they need because in certain cases motorcyclists may be gearing down so you're not seeing their break lights come on. That will make you obviously close the proximity in your distance a lot faster."
Sanchuk recommends things like frequently checking your mirrors, driving defensively and avoiding all distractions to help keep roadways safer for everyone.
He adds that we need to share the road with everybody.
"We need to respect everyone on our roadways. Our pedestrians, our motorcycle operators, our bicyclists and our motor vehicle operators. So when we are out there on the roadway we need to share it."
